MICHAEL G. WINER

July 17, 2008

Winer-Michael Gene “Mike” on July 17, 2008. He was the beloved husband of Elaine (Family) Winer and loving father of Lisa Winer of San Francisco, CA and Lowell Winer of Los Angeles, CA. His parents louis and Eleanor Winer and brother Stephan are now deceased. Mike attended Ohio State University, worked in material handling sales for many years and as manager of Highway Driver Leasing. A veteran of the Korean War, he was very interested in history and politics and a great conversationalist on these subjects. Graveside services on Monday, July 21 at 10:45 am at Sharon Memorial Park, Sharon. Remembrances may be made to the American Heart Association, American Diabetes Asssociation or the Salvation Army.

MARTIN SIGEL

July 16, 2008

Martin Sigel, of Malden,died on July 16, 2008 at the Kathleen Daniel Nursing Home in Framingham. He was 79. Mr. Sigel was born in Chelsea, MA. For many years he was a draftsman working with the Army Corps of Engineers. He was the son of the late Hyman Sigel and Betty (Margolis) Sigel. He leaves his wife Ruth (Jacobs) Sigel; his nieces and nephews, Arlene and Larry DeHaan of Framingham, Jeffrey and Cheryl Dorenfeld of Reading. Also survived by several other loving n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ews. Funeral services will be held at the Brezniak-Rodman Chapel, 1251 Washington St. (Corner of Chestnut Street) , West Newton on Friday, July 18 at 11:00 am. Memorial observance will be at the home of Arlene and Larry DeHaan, on Friday until sundown, Sat evening, Sunday and Monday after 1 pm. Remembrances may be made to either the Kathleen Daniels Nursing Home, 45 Franklin St. Framingham, MA 01702 or to the Allegiance Hospice, 67 Middle Street, Suite 503, Lowell, MA 01852.
